As of yesterday, NetAdvantage shipped a beta of the 2005.3 release for Visual Studio 2005.  One of the things this does is change the assembly name from Infragistics.xxx to Infragistics2.xxx in addition to the obvious part of NetAdvantage being compiled against CLR 2.0.  So, what do we have to do in order to enable you to develop your WinForms applications in VS2005 utilizing the .NET Framework 2.0 and test them with TestAdvantage?  We need to change some references, build against CLR 2.0, and test it.  We build against the release build of NetAdvantage, so you can expect to see a release of TestAdvantage at the latest a month after the final release of NetAdvantage.

*Note: Since TestAdvantage is sold as a subscription, these bits will be provided under the subscription agreement.
